Peruvian winger giving little thought to transfer rumours

Juan Manuel Vargas has distanced himself from reports linking him with a move to Real Madrid. The Fiorentina winger is believed to be on Real's radar ahead of the January transfer window, with the Spaniards preparing a big-money approach. The Peru international has seen his profile rise considerably over recent years, with a move to Florence from Catania in 2008 providing him with a grander stage on which to display his talents. Vargas insists he is not actively seeking a New Year switch, and is instead fully focused on life in Italy, but has hinted that he could be tempted by a fresh challenge in the future. "I don't like to look too far ahead," the 26-year-old told La Nazione. "I prefer to live day by day and for now that means, at this moment, there is only Fiorentina. "I want to grow up here, I want to help push the team to the top and then maybe in June or in a few years' time we'll see." He added: "Real Madrid? That is just a rumour. It is not the time to start talking about the future."
